Lithium-ion batteries have revolutionized power storage thanks to their lightweight nature, high energy density, and low self-discharge rates. Unlike traditional lead-acid batteries, 12V lithium-ion batteries are more compact, making them perfect for the mobility scooter market where space and weight are at a premium. With the ability to retain a charge longer and requiring less frequent replacements, these batteries are becoming the gold standard for mobility solutions.
1. Increased Lifecycle: One of the standout benefits of lithium-ion batteries is their high lifecycle. They can withstand hundreds to thousands of charge cycles, ensuring that users get longevity and value.
2. Lightweight and Compact: Weighing significantly less than lead-acid alternatives, these batteries allow manufacturers to produce lighter scooters, thereby improving maneuverability and ease of transport.
3. Faster Charging: With rapid charge capabilities, reaching full capacity can take a fraction of the time compared to traditional batteries, providing users with greater convenience.
4. Consistent Performance: Lithium-ion batteries maintain a stable voltage through most of the discharge cycle, meaning that users can enjoy reliable performance without the dip in power.
5. Environmental Benefits: Unlike lead-acid batteries, lithium-ion options are less toxic and easier to recycle, making them a more environmentally friendly choice.

Today’s lithium-ion batteries are not just technological marvels; they are also integrated with smart technologies. Many lithium-ion batteries for mobility scooters come equipped with Bluetooth capabilities to allow users to track battery health and performance through a mobile application. This level of integration enhances the user experience, offering more control and insight into how the battery operates.
